Career opportunities

Below is a partial list of career roles where you can leverage a Professional Certificate in Dyslexia and Reading Difficulties in Inclusive Education to advance your professional endeavors.

Special Educational Needs Coordinator (SENCO)

Oversee support for students with dyslexia and reading difficulties, ensuring inclusive education practices are implemented effectively.

Dyslexia Specialist Teacher

Provide tailored instruction and interventions to students with dyslexia, focusing on literacy development and reading strategies.

Inclusive Education Consultant

Advise schools and institutions on best practices for supporting students with dyslexia and reading challenges in mainstream classrooms.

Learning Support Assistant

Work directly with students with dyslexia, offering one-on-one support and helping them access the curriculum effectively.

Course content

• Foundations of Dyslexia: Understanding Causes, Characteristics, and Identification
• Inclusive Education Strategies for Supporting Students with Reading Difficulties
• Multisensory Teaching Approaches for Dyslexia and Literacy Development
• Assistive Technologies and Tools for Enhancing Reading Skills
• Assessment and Intervention Planning for Dyslexia in Diverse Classrooms
• Building Phonological Awareness and Decoding Skills in Struggling Readers
• Creating Inclusive Learning Environments for Students with Dyslexia
• Collaborative Approaches: Working with Parents, Educators, and Specialists
• Legal and Ethical Considerations in Dyslexia Education and Support
• Research-Based Practices for Long-Term Literacy Success in Inclusive Settings
